For years mechanical keys to cars were the only basic security to vehicles. They are fast becoming obsolete as automakers incorporate microchips into their locks and ignition systems.

Transponder keys are the majority of the microchip-equipped modern keys. These types of keys have microchips inside them that send out a unique digital signature when inserted into the keyhole or turned on in the ignition. The immobilizer is disarmed and the vehicle will begin to start when a matching digital fingerprint is detected.

What is a key-cutting machine?

Key cutting machines are a piece of equipment that helps you create new keys or duplicates of existing ones. They come in many different designs however, they all function in the same manner. They trace the profile of the key blank on the blank key and cut the profile using a knife. This produces a perfectly duplicated key that is ready to use in your locks.

You'll need to choose the correct machine based on the type of key you are cutting. Some keys are tubular while others are cylindrical, with an extended blade and bow and others require a pocket to be cut into (mortice). You'll need a key cutter that can cut different shapes of keys.

Another thing to take into consideration when choosing a key-cutting machine is its capacity to cut multiple keys at the same time. This is particularly useful if your business requires you to cut many identical key sets. It will save time and money. Some of the most sophisticated machines can be programmed to automatically repeat the same cutting process over and over again making it quicker and simpler to get your keys cut.

Manual originating key cutting machines require you to manually move the original key as well as the key blank along the tracer wheel and cutter wheel. This can be difficult for those working with thicker keys or an unfamiliar machine. It is essential to choose an item from a reputable manufacturer that comes with a solid warranty, replacement parts, and is easy-to-use. JMA Nomad or Silca Flash are great options.

Automatic Originating Key Cutting Machines are a bit more expensive than manual machines, but they provide a variety of benefits. They are computer-driven and let you indicate the type of key you need to cut (single edge-cut on the side, double side edge-cut, single external laser-cut or double external laser-cut) and then leave while it cuts the blank for you. Some of the most popular models that are available today are the Ilco Futura Edge and Pro machines, or the Laser Key Products 3D Elite machine.

How do I use the key-cutting machine?


Using a key-cutting machine to make duplicate keys is not difficult, but it is vital to follow the guidelines of your particular machine. To ensure that online is operating correctly, you must regularly clean and oil it.

There are three kinds of key-cutting equipment: Manual, semi-automatic, and automatic. Selecting the type of key to be cut is the initial step. The type of key on the original key as well as the type of key you can cut with your key-cutting machine will typically determine this. If you are only going to be duplicating Edge style keys, then a Edge Manual machine like the JMA Nomad, Silca Flash or Silca 045 is the best choice. The Keyline Arcadia will also allow you to cut Tubular style keys.

Then, you must insert the original key in the first vice and then place the blank key into the second vice. Both keys should be securely secured to stop them from moving during the process of duplication. Close the cover to protect the keys and switch on the machine. After the key has been cut, you can take it off the machine and use a key brush to brush off any small metal pieces left from the cut.

Semi-Automatic Machines are similar to Key-cutting machines that are manually operated, but there are some differences. The main difference is that the carriage (the part that holds the keys) is spring loaded and it presses tight against the key tracer and cutter wheel. It isn't necessary to be as precise in the key's position and you can let the machine cut the key. The top semi-automatic machines are the Silca Futura Auto, Futura Pro and the Laser Key Products 3D Extreme.

Automatic machines are the most advanced and newest kind of key-cutting machine that are available. Computer-driven, you'll spend most of your time in software telling it what to cut. These machines are very accurate and you can leave while the key is being cut. The most reliable automated machines are the Silca Futura Auto, Futura Pro or the Laser Key Products 3D Extreme.
